NASA TV UFOs:
NASA STS-119 Mission UFO Footage
Several UFOs were filmed by NASA during the STS-119 Mission.
The flight path of the unknown object which can be seen 38 seconds into the video seems to turn to the left:
http://www.youtube.com/watch?v=6MvFoAy2R9U
The NASA STS-119 (ISS assembly flight 15A) Space Shuttle Discovery mission:
Launch date: 15 March 2009 -
Landing date: 28 March 2009.